2026-06-15 08:06:08 +03:00
|
|
|
{
|
|
|
|
|
"skill": "rector",
|
|
|
|
|
"kind": "external",
|
2026-06-19 10:27:39 +03:00
|
|
|
"needs": [
|
|
|
|
|
"php-source"
|
|
|
|
|
],
|
|
|
|
|
"produces": [
|
|
|
|
|
"refactored-php"
|
|
|
|
|
],
|
|
|
|
|
"constraints": [
|
|
|
|
|
"вручную/CI, не блокирует коммит",
|
|
|
|
|
"ADR-013: BT1 НЕ Pint (трансформация vs формат), BT2 комплементарен Larastan, BT3 НЕ deptrac"
|
|
|
|
|
],
|
2026-06-15 08:06:08 +03:00
|
|
|
"preview-form": "dry-run",
|
2026-06-19 10:27:39 +03:00
|
|
|
"defaults": [
|
|
|
|
|
"dry-run baseline; conservative ruleset"
|
|
|
|
|
],
|
|
|
|
|
"key-decisions": [
|
|
|
|
|
"какие правила трансформации"
|
|
|
|
|
],
|
|
|
|
|
"acceptance-criteria": [
|
|
|
|
|
"код трансформирован, тесты зелёные"
|
|
|
|
|
],
|
|
|
|
|
"source": {
|
|
|
|
|
"version": "n/a",
|
|
|
|
|
"hash": "0000000000000000000000000000000000000000000000000000000000000000",
|
|
|
|
|
"path": ""
|
|
|
|
|
}
|
2026-06-15 08:06:08 +03:00
|
|
|
}
|